The intranet is dead, long live the intranet? A look back at the Arctus 2025 study

Every year, Arctus' Intranet Observatory provides an overview of the state of internal digital technology in French organizations. The 2025 edition confirms that the intranet remains a pillar of the work environment, deemed “indispensable or necessary” by 94% of respondents. However, behind these unsurprising figures, there are signs of a slowdown: intranets are becoming less customized and increasingly reliant on the Microsoft 365 ecosystem, and there is a growing gap between available features and actual usage.
